Hi Carolyn. My name is Cindy. Begin by putting your CD's in a bath towel and smashing them with a hammer. Next, glue them to your table top. Wait for the glue to dry completely (next day is ideal). Then mix your grout and spread the grout on top of the CD's using a trowel. Try to get the grout in all the nooks and crannies. Allow the grout to dry completely (again, the next day is ideal). Lastly you should remove all of the excess grout. You will need a bucket of warm water and a large sponge. Like a large car wash sponge. When the grout fills the bottom of the bucket, dump it and continue on with another bucket of warm water. Once all the excess grout is gone, shine it with a clean towel. PS. Sanded grout is for floors, and unsanded grout is for mosaics, and walls. I hope this info helps you. Best wishes.
